Growth Team Manages Cadence

• Start with growth master + ad hoc team

• Ad hoc team: designer, analyst, engineer, ideally key execs (CEO, VP Product…)

• Add dedicated growth roles as needed

• Weekly test launch goals and weekly growth meeting

13@SeanEllis @GrowthHackers

Weekly Growth Meeting Agenda

• 15 Min: Growth metrics, issues and opportunities

• 10 min: Review last week’s testing sprint

• 15 min: Key lessons learned from analyzed tests

• 15 min: Select tests for this week’s sprint

• 5 min: Check growth of idea backlog

Manage Testing

• Assign each test to a project manager

• Anyone on growth team can be a project mgr

• Run tests sufficient time

18@SeanEllis @GrowthHackers

Analyze Results

• Always ask why

• Systematize on learning

• Informs follow up tests

• Revisit past programs
